| -- Reasonably efficient pagination without OFFSET | |
| -- SQLite version (Adapted from MS SQL syntax) | |
| -- Source: http://www.phpbuilder.com/board/showpost.php?p=10376515&postcount=6 | |
| SELECT foo, bar, baz, quux FROM table | |
| WHERE oid NOT IN ( SELECT oid FROM table | |
| ORDER BY title ASC LIMIT 50 ) | |
| ORDER BY title ASC LIMIT 10 |
This is a quick guide to OAuth2 support in GitHub for developers. This is still experimental and could change at any moment. This Gist will serve as a living document until it becomes finalized at Develop.GitHub.com.
OAuth2 is a protocol that lets external apps request authorization to private details in your GitHub account without getting your password. All developers need to register their application before getting started.
